Many diagnostic test studies involve multiple readers. The design and analysis of these studies is complex due to the reader variability. In this study, I evaluate the impact of reader variability on the performance estimates. Some commonly used statistical methods are evaluated. Simulated data will be used to evaluate the robustness of those methods.
